RNA5SP248
Summary
RNA5SP248 is a pseudogene[1].
Key Facts
- RNA5SP248's instance of is recorded as pseudogene[2].
- RNA5SP248's instance of is recorded as gene[3].
- RNA5SP248 is a type of pseudogene[4].
- RNA5SP248's genomic start is recorded as 140386781[5].
- RNA5SP248's genomic end is recorded as 140386907[6].
- RNA5SP248's found in taxon is recorded as Homo sapiens[7].
- RNA5SP248's chromosome is recorded as human chromosome 7[8].
- RNA5SP248's strand orientation is recorded as reverse strand[9].
- RNA5SP248's exact match is recorded as http://identifiers.org/ncbigene/100873504[10].
- RNA5SP248's cytogenetic location is recorded as 7q34[11].
